Pattern Peyote Triangle

I always use Toho or Miyuki Delica beads because, in my opinion, they get the best results..... To make it easy it is best to work with 2 different colors of beads..... We will call them A and B

Step 1 

On a comfortable length of thread pick up 3 beads A and go through them again to make a ring as shown on the drawing below

Step 2

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ead. I have made the beads from the previous drawing light grey and the newly added beads black.

Step 3 

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ead.

Step 4 

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ead.

Step 5 

Now we need to step up to the next round by going through the first A bead added in step 2.

Step 6 

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ead.

Step 7 

Pick up one bead B and go through the next A bead. From here on the newly added B beads will be red and the ones from previous rounds will be pink.

Step 8 

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ead.

Step 9 

Pick up one bead B and go through the next A bead.

Step 10 

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ead.

Step 11 

Pick up one bead B and go through the next A bead.

Step 12 

Step up to the next round as you did in step 5

Step 13 

Pick up 2 beads A and go through the next A bead.

Step 14 

We will add 2 beads B instead of one now.

Step 15 

Repeat this for the rest of this round and step up to the next round as you did before

Step 16 

In the next round we will add 3 beads B instead of 2 and so on

Step 17 

You can make it as big as you want - to end it you make a round by just adding one bead A on the 3 corners.
There is a lot you can do with these..... You can make them into earrings or make several triangles and put them together to make a bracelet 😃
